DEV Community

Etelligens Technologies
Etelligens Technologies

Posted on

Software Testing Trends To Watch Out In 2022

Software testing is a crucial phase of the software development life cycle. It helps in finding bugs or errors and improves the software quality.

Quality Assurance (QA) or testing is an ever-changing and evolving role.

The importance of quality assurance has grown, and it is now more strategic. If you are a QA tester or part of a QA team, you need to keep up with the trends of the industry changes to stay ahead of the software testing game. This post discusses what the future holds for QA testing.

Image description

AI & ML Testing

Artificial Intelligence (AI) and Machine Learning (ML) techniques help software testers in their day-to-day tasks. It may help QA teams uncover flaws earlier, enhance test coverage, and identify high-risk areas.

With AI testing, you can create intelligent test cases, automate the execution of test cases, discover flaws, and recommend remedies based on software business data.

QA also utilizes different machine learning approaches to automate test cases and find anomalies in software. With ML testing, you can create bots that interact with the application and track every action they take.

IoT Testing

The Internet of Things (IoT) is established on integrating all devices into a single network, thus the name. This notion has been in the works for quite some time. The 5G network was instrumental in popularizing this form of testing. It improves the speed of processing, receiving, and sending data, resulting in more secure operations. The software testing teams are now preparing to use this strategy. The reason for this is the development of creative and new software for several devices.

Cloud-Based Testing

Writing codes for different devices and browsers are outdated. With technological improvements enabling cross-platform development, automating testing procedures is now the new normal. Companies are actively using cloud-based cross-browser testing methodologies to cut costs and improve scalability. This method allows QA teams to test their web apps across different devices, operating systems, and browsers without compromising the quality of results.

Codeless Automation Testing

Codeless Automation Testing is undoubtedly the future of automation testing. Codeless automation is getting more popular as it may speed up the entire testing process and save time. They are ready–to–use programs, so the testers will not have to learn coding from scratch. You may save money while simultaneously freeing up resources. Moreover, it allows organizations to accomplish the same automation in less time and with significantly fewer resources. Because of these characteristics, the worldwide codeless testing market forecast remains quite good.

QAOps

QAOps brings developers, testers, and operations engineers together to integrate Quality Assurance (QA) and IT Operations in the Software Development Life Cycle (Ops). Due to DevOps adoption, we're witnessing a surge in QAOps across numerous businesses. It helps companies enhance software delivery workflows and procedures without affecting the app quality. It integrates QA approaches with IT operations and software development to create a long-term, integrated delivery strategy.

API & Services Test Automation

Testing APIs and services across client apps and components are more effective and efficient than testing the client alone. The need for API and service test automation is growing, perhaps overtaking the demand for end-user functionality on user interfaces. For API automation testing, having the correct method, tool, and the solution is more important than ever. As a result, understanding the ideal API Testing Tools for your testing projects is worthwhile.

Testing Center Of Excellence (TCoE)

Testing teams are under continual pressure to save development time while maintaining quality. As a result, the emergence of testing centers of excellence is another software testing trend you can expect this year.

The demand for standardized testing methods and tools is higher than ever. One of the most efficient approaches to accomplish standardized testing procedures is establishing a TCoE. Companies that have not created a TCoE will most likely do so in the coming times.

Bottomline

With the current trends, software testing is gaining popularity. Businesses are following these trends to bring high-quality products to market. To keep ahead in the ever-changing world, whether you're a testing professional or a firm, you need to be continually aware of these software testing trends.

Top comments (0)